#include <Expr_FunctionDerivative.hxx>

Public Member Functions | |
| Expr_FunctionDerivative (const occ::handle< Expr_GeneralFunction > &func, const occ::handle< Expr_NamedUnknown > &withX, const int deg) | |
| Creates a FunctionDerivative of degree <deg> relative to the <withX> variable. Raises OutOfRange if <deg> lower or equal to zero. | |
| int | NbOfVariables () const override |
| Returns the number of variables of <me>. | |
| occ::handle< Expr_NamedUnknown > | Variable (const int index) const override |
| Returns the variable denoted by <index> in <me>. Raises OutOfRange if <index> greater than NbOfVariables of <me>. | |
| double | Evaluate (const NCollection_Array1< occ::handle< Expr_NamedUnknown > > &vars, const NCollection_Array1< double > &values) const override |
| Computes the value of <me> with the given variables. Raises DimensionMismatch if Length(vars) is different from Length(values). | |
| occ::handle< Expr_GeneralFunction > | Copy () const override |
| Returns a copy of <me> with the same form. | |
| occ::handle< Expr_GeneralFunction > | Derivative (const occ::handle< Expr_NamedUnknown > &var) const override |
| Returns Derivative of <me> for variable . | |
| occ::handle< Expr_GeneralFunction > | Derivative (const occ::handle< Expr_NamedUnknown > &var, const int deg) const override |
| Returns Derivative of <me> for variable with degree <deg>. | |
| bool | IsIdentical (const occ::handle< Expr_GeneralFunction > &func) const override |
| Tests if <me> and <func> are similar functions (same name and same used expression). | |
| bool | IsLinearOnVariable (const int index) const override |
| Tests if <me> is linear on variable on range <index> | |
| occ::handle< Expr_GeneralFunction > | Function () const |
| Returns the function of which <me> is the derivative. | |
| int | Degree () const |
| Returns the degree of derivation of <me>. | |
| occ::handle< Expr_NamedUnknown > | DerivVariable () const |
| Returns the derivation variable of <me>. | |

| void | IncrementRefCounter () noexcept |
| Increments the reference counter of this object. Uses relaxed memory ordering since incrementing only requires atomicity, not synchronization with other memory operations. | |
| int | DecrementRefCounter () noexcept |
| Decrements the reference counter of this object; returns the decremented value. Uses release ordering for the decrement to ensure all writes to the object are visible before the count reaches zero. An acquire fence is added only when the count reaches zero, ensuring proper synchronization before deletion. This is more efficient than using acq_rel for every decrement. | |
